Jobs for MBA in finance graduates
Finance Manager
This profile brings in individuals with financial management expertise to steer the finance of various projects undertaken by the organization. He ensures the optimized use of every single financial resource available. Sometimes a portfolio manager dons the role of project manager too.
Treasury Accountant
Such individuals are young fresh MBA finance graduates. Their job involves ensuring both periodic and daily analysis of company’s cash flow.
Accounting Analyst
These individuals have opportunities in varied industries especially banking, stocks and accounting. Profile of a financial analyst has requisites like accounting compensation management, budgeting, forecasting with immense knowledge and understanding of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P).

Financial Analyst
In the financial industry, especially banking and stocks financial analyst’s skills remain to be of ratio analysis, forecasting over rating agencies, data mining and reporting over the fluctuating stocks, etc.
Private Equity Analyst
Such individual uses his knack of financial modeling techniques. He offers his services to various private equity firms. He is entrusted with the handling of portfolios of private equity firms and private companies. He plays with Internal Rate of Return (IRR) and Discounted Cash Flows (DCF).
Hedge Fund Analyst
Such analysts for a hedge fund pool up the investments taken from High Net Individuals (HNI).Here analysts use their commendable analytics skills in finance. They raise such funds which ensure minimization of risk and investment return maximization.
Investment Banking Analyst
Most of the MBA finance graduates with keen interest in banking can get openings as investment banking analysts. Core skills required of such analysts are identifying and defining of project, followed by scope of project. They remain in tune with workload and sponsors backing the project.
Stock Market Research Analyst
Doing detailed research of companies to refine the inputs for investors is their main job. These wolves of stock exchange are the actual game changers. Companies keep their fingers crossed in the hope that these analysts are spreading the right word about them.
Investment Consultant
Next follow up stage of a financial analyst is to wear the cap of an investment consultant. He either gets employed formally with organizations or he offers his consultancy services to the corporate or financial institutional clients in return of huge money as remuneration.
Chief Financial Officer
He is one above all in the organization responsible for financial affairs. He makes the trinity with CEO, CTO and serves to be an important leg in decision making. He ensures better prospects for the organization by applying his forte into many things like revenue opportunities, economic trends, expansion prospects, system enhancement and cost reduction.
